Loudspeaker protection

The loudspeaker is equipped with a thermal protection system which prevents damage from overheating. If an error occurs – or the speaker units become overheated – the system automatically switches the loudspeaker to standby.

To restore the sound:

>Disconnect the loudspeaker from the mains supply.

>Allow the system time to reset or cool down (approximately 3–5 minutes).

>Reconnect the loudspeaker to the mains supply.

Should the problem persist, contact your Bang & Olufsen retailer.

To clean the loudspeaker

Clean dusty surfaces using a dry, soft cloth. If necessary, remove grease stains or persistent dirt with

alint-free, firmly wrung cloth, dipped in a solution of water containing only a few drops of mild detergent, such as washing- up liquid.

Never use a vacuum cleaner to clean the exposed speaker membrane in the acoustic lens. However, the loudspeaker front cloth may be cleaned with a vacuum cleaner with a soft brush nozzle, and set to the lowest level.

Never use alcohol or other solvents to clean any parts of the loud­ speaker!

To switch on and off

When you switch on your Bang & Olufsen system, the loudspeaker switches on simultaneously, and when you switch the system off again, the loudspeaker also switches to standby.

!

Caution: Do not touch the exposed speaker membrane in the acoustic lens!
